# Environment
|
||||
|
||||
> ⚠ Available since version `v1.3.0`
|
||||
|
||||
Sometimes it's favorable not having the encryption keys in the config files.
|
||||
For that `autorestic` allows passing the backend keys as `ENV` variables, or through an env file.
|
||||
|
||||
The syntax for the `ENV` variables is as follows: `AUTORESTIC_[BACKEND NAME]_KEY`.
|
||||
|
||||
```yaml | autorestic.yaml
|
||||
backend:
|
||||
foo:
|
||||
type: ...
|
||||
path: ...
|
||||
key: secret123 # => AUTORESTIC_FOO_KEY=secret123
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Example
|
||||
|
||||
This means we could remove `key: secret123` from `.autorestic.yaml` and execute as follows: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
AUTORESTIC_FOO_KEY=secret123 autorestic backup ...
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Env file
|
||||
|
||||
Alternatively `autorestic` can load an env file, located next to `autorestic.yml` called `.autorestic.env`.
|
||||
|
||||
```| .autorestic.env
|
||||
AUTORESTIC_FOO_KEY=secret123
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
after that you can simply use `autorestic` as your are used to.

## Aliases
|
||||
|
||||
A handy tool for more advanced configurations is to use yaml aliases.
|
||||
These must be specified under the global `extras` key in the `.autorestic.yml` config file.
|
||||
Aliases allow to reuse snippets of config throughout the same file.
|
||||
|
||||
The following example shows how the locations `a` and `b` share the same hooks and forget policies.
|
||||
|
||||
```yaml | .autorestic.yml
|
||||
extras:
|
||||
hooks: &foo
|
||||
before:
|
||||
- echo "Hello"
|
||||
after:
|
||||
- echo "kthxbye"
|
||||
policies: &bar
|
||||
keep-daily: 14
|
||||
keep-weekly: 52
|
||||
|
||||
backends:
|
||||
# ...
|
||||
locations:
|
||||
a:
|
||||
from: /data/a
|
||||
to: some
|
||||
hooks:
|
||||
<<: *foo
|
||||
options:
|
||||
forget:
|
||||
<<: *bar
|
||||
b:
|
||||
from: data/b
|
||||
to: some
|
||||
hooks:
|
||||
<<: *foo
|
||||
options:
|
||||
forget:
|
||||
<<: *bar
|
||||
```

## Environment variables
|
||||
|
||||
All hooks are exposed to the `AUTORESTIC_LOCATION` environment variable, which contains the location name.
|
||||
|
||||
The `after` and `success` hooks have access to additional information with the following syntax: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
AUTORESTIC_[TYPE]_[I]
|
||||
AUTORESTIC_[TYPE]_[BACKEND_NAME]
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Every type of metadata is appended with both the name of the backend associated with and the number in which the backends where executed.
|
||||
|
||||
### Available Metadata Types
|
||||
|
||||
- `SNAPSHOT_ID`
|
||||
- `PARENT_SNAPSHOT_ID`
|
||||
- `FILES_ADDED`
|
||||
- `FILES_CHANGED`
|
||||
- `FILES_UNMODIFIED`
|
||||
- `DIRS_ADDED`
|
||||
- `DIRS_CHANGED`
|
||||
- `DIRS_UNMODIFIED`
|
||||
- `ADDED_SIZE`
|
||||
- `PROCESSED_FILES`
|
||||
- `PROCESSED_SIZE`
|
||||
- `PROCESSED_DURATION`
|
||||
|
||||
#### Example
|
||||
|
||||
Assuming you have a location `bar` that backs up to a single backend named `foo` you could expect the following env variables: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
AUTORESTIC_LOCATION=bar
|
||||
AUTORESTIC_FILES_ADDED_0=42
|
||||
AUTORESTIC_FILES_ADDED_FOO=42
|
||||
```
